The Growing Market for Incontinence Products
According to a report by Grand View Research, the global market for incontinence products is expected to reach $18.4 billion by 2025. In the United States alone, the market for incontinence products is projected to be worth $3.3 billion by 2023, with a compound annual growth rate of 6.6% from 2019 to 2023.
Rising Demand for Incontinence Products
The increasing prevalence of incontinence among the aging population is a key factor driving the demand for incontinence products. According to the National Association for Continence, over 25 million Americans are affected by urinary incontinence, while over 16 million Americans are affected by bowel incontinence.
Types of Incontinence Products
There are a variety of incontinence products available on the market to help manage the symptoms of incontinence. These products include:
- Disposable adult diapers
- Adult pull-up underwear
- Underpads and bed pads
- Incontinence liners and pads
- Male guards and female guards
